I have a 1985 mercruiser 4 cyl with alpha one outdrive. Problem is I hit ground and now am getting no prop response at all. The boat does not even seem to be shifting into gear. There is no feel of going into forward or reverse. Not really sure where to start. Prop turns by hand in gear in the correct direction and then makes kinda of a "klunking" sound in the other direction. The shifter seems to be working fine but when I throttle up the engine just revs and the prop does not turn either direction. Any advise on where to begin is appreciated. Thanks in advance.

Re: Hard Prop Hit, Now Prop Not Spinning.

First off do not run it any more, because your impeller is probably not pumping water and you will very quickly burn your shutters and engine exhaust bellows. It sounds like internal damage to the outdrive possibly a broken driveshaft (the vertical shaft between the gearhousing and the driveshaft housing). Probably time to pull the outdrive ans separate the upper and lower and take a look.

How fast were you going when you hit ground? If very slow you may have just ruined the prop hub. If you doing any kind of speed you need to remove the OD and check it out. Until you are DO NOT run it.

Doubt highly it's a spun hub.... More likely the shaft....even a spun hub will spin the prop but slip under load....and no clunking sound...Pull the lower unit and have a look see ;)
